Burnout Revenge Soundtrack Revealed
August 23rd, 2005 (9:16pm) - Electronic Arts has revealed the in-game music soundtrack for Burnout Revenge. Featuring a mix of over 40 punk, metal, hard rock, alternative rock, electronic songs from bands around the world, the in-game music soundtrack is headlined by the world debut of Lights And Sounds from the chart-breaking rock quintet Yellowcard.
Blowing the doors of the Burnout Revenge soundtrack are songs from a huge variety of artists including big name acts The Chemical Brothers, Fall Out Boy, Thrice, The Bravery and BTs unique remix of Break On Through (To The Other Side) from the legendary band, The Doors.
